ECMT 130 - Electrical Laboratory I


Credit Hours: 4
Lecture Hours: 0
Laboratory Hours: 12

Prerequisite(s): None

Restriction(s): None

Corequisite(s): None

This course involves the planning, installation, and maintenance of residential electrical equipment. It provides the opportunity for students to develop and demonstrate their technical competencies on actual project work and, when available, field projects.

Student Learning Outcomes of the Course:
  1. Design, plan, install and maintain residential electrical equipment in accordance with the standards required by the National Electrical Code.
  2. Comprehend and interpret the National Electrical Code regulations to ensure code compliance, and demonstrates the skills required to perform the necessary calculations.
  3. Demonstrate the ability to plan, install, and maintain residential and commercial electrical systems.
  4. Design and draw wiring and schematic diagrams.
  5. Demonstrate workmanship in electrical installations consistent with accepted industry practices.
  6. Demonstrate the ability to safely use common test equipment.
